VitaFlex makes money the same way it helps businesses: by creating value and solving real business problems. Four engines — one-time projects, recurring services, expansion, and partnerships.
Businesses engage VitaFlex for specific projects: a Google Business Profile built and optimized for a business that is invisible, a website scoped to the business’s real goals. The project is written down — scope, price, timeline — before work begins, and it has complete value on its own.
A digital presence decays without care. Monthly services keep a business visible: social media that keeps getting made, a Google profile that stays current, reviews answered, performance reported. Recurring revenue exists because the work keeps creating value every month it continues — and clients renew because stopping would be a loss, not a saving.
Existing clients adopt additional solutions when legitimate business needs are identified: a second location, a campaign for a product launch, a website to go with the social presence, a higher level of strategic involvement. Expansion is a response to the business’s reality changing — not a quota.
VitaFlex collaborates with organizations and entrepreneurial partners where there is mutual value. The Business Partner Network extends VitaFlex’s reach: trained partners recognize and document legitimate opportunities in their communities, and VitaFlex conducts the formal business process. Public package pricing is published on the Packages page. VitaFlex does not publish internal compensation structures, partner commission figures or other confidential commercial terms. If a term is not public, it is discussed in a formal conversation — in writing.
Every engine earns the same way: the value of problems solved, expressed in projects, services and growth engagements.
Scope, price and terms are documented before work begins. Special pricing is decided by administration, never improvised.
VitaFlex does not publish revenue figures, projections or guarantees. Claims we would not defend in a conversation do not get published.
